Accused Drunk Driver Crashes Into Verizon Wireless Arena

MANCHESTER, N.H. (CBS) – An accused drunk driver led police on a wild chase and ended up crashing into the Verizon Wireless Arena early Monday morning, investigators said.

Police say 26-year-old Juan Ponce of Manchester refused to pull over for a traffic stop around 4:30 a.m. near Wilson Street and then sped off in his Volkswagen Jetta.

Officers ended the chase moments later as the Jetta continued on "at excessive speeds."

As police approached the arena on Elm Street they found the car had crashed into the east side of the building.

It had gone through a hallway and slammed into the outer wall of a suite.

Police said Ponce ran off, but an officer caught him "as he attempted to scale a fence on the south side of the building."

A passenger in the car, 24-year-old Eduardo Rubio Cornejo of Manchester, ran off into the arena, police said.

He was caught, arrested and charged with "resisting detention and criminal trespass."

Pone was taken to the hospital where he was treated for minor injuries.

He's charged with disobeying a police officer, reckless conduct; conduct after an accident; aggravated OUI liquor; resisting arrest; and assault on a police officer.
